用 JavaScript 显示消息的 6 种方法317


在 JavaScript 中,有许多方法可以用来向用户显示消息。这些方法在不同的情况下可能有用,并且各有优缺点。在本文中,我们将探讨六种在 JavaScript 中显示消息的不同方法,以及每种方法的最佳用例。

1. alert()

alert() 方法是向用户显示消息最简单的方法之一。它将弹出一个带有指定消息的对话框,并且用户必须点击“确定”才能关闭对话框。alert() 方法非常简单,但是它有一些缺点。首先,它会中断用户体验,因为用户必须停止他们正在做的事情来查看消息。此外,alert() 方法不能用于显示复杂的 HTML 内容。```javascript
alert("Hello, world!");
```

2. confirm()

confirm() 方法类似于 alert() 方法,但它会弹出一个带有消息和两个按钮(“确定”和“取消”)的对话框。confirm() 方法返回值 true 或 false,具体取决于用户单击哪个按钮。confirm() 方法可用于处理需要用户确认的操作。```javascript
var result = confirm("Are you sure you want to delete this file?");
if (result) {
// 删除文件
}
```

3. prompt()

prompt() 方法类似于 confirm() 方法,但它会弹出一个带有消息和输入字段的对话框。prompt() 方法返回值用户输入的内容,或者如果用户点击“取消”则为 null。prompt() 方法可用于收集用户输入。```javascript
var username = prompt("What is your username?");
if (username) {
// 使用用户名
}
```

4. ()

() 方法将消息打印到浏览器的控制台。() 方法非常有用,用于调试目的,因为它允许您查看程序执行期间发生的事情。() 方法不会向用户显示任何消息,但它可以用于调试和故障排除。```javascript
("Hello, world!");
```

5. ()

() 方法将消息写入文档中。() 方法非常强大,因为它允许您控制文档的内容。() 方法可以用来向文档中添加 HTML、CSS 和 JavaScript。但是,() 方法也会中断用户体验,因为它会刷新整个文档。```javascript
("Hello, world!");
```

6. 第三方库

除了上面列出的方法之外,还有许多用于在 JavaScript 中显示消息的第三方库。这些库提供了更高级的功能,例如自定义样式、动画和交互性。一些流行的 JavaScript 消息库包括:
toastr
甜警报
通知.js

选择使用哪种方法来显示消息取决于您的特定需求。如果您需要向用户显示一个简单的快速消息,那么 alert() 或 confirm() 方法可能就足够了。如果您需要显示更复杂的消息或想要更多控制显示方式,那么第三方库可能是一个更好的选择。

2024-12-28


上一篇:JavaScript 中的字节数组:byte[]

下一篇:JavaScript 中的搜索技术